购买理由
买这个游标卡尺,是平时偶尔测量问题尺寸,有时候用不锈钢直尺,不方便,也不准确。就想买一款测量方便 又比较准确的游标卡尺。想着耐用一点,就没有考虑那种二三十元的塑料材质的 游标卡尺,最后从价格评论等方面,选择了本次晒单的鸣固游标卡尺。京东自营报价109元。

使用感受
先看看重量。184g。
测硬币看看。0.5元的直径20.48mm。标准尺寸好像是25mm。
再看看1元硬币。结果是25.02mm。标准好像是25mm
总结
这个游标卡尺,用起来可以,价格不算特别便宜。产品细节方面,还有待改善,比如标签问题和全英文的说明书。

井索雯3717如图所示的游标卡尺可用来测理物体的外径尺寸、内径尺寸,还可以图用来测量容器的 - -----,该尺游标尺上的 -
狄凤帜18456311339 ______ 根据游标卡尺的构造可知,游标卡尺可用来测理量物体的外径尺寸、内径尺寸,还可以图用来测量容器的深度;由图可知,该游标卡尺的游标上有10个刻度,其总长度为9mm,因此该尺游标尺上的每一个小刻度的长度为0.9mm;游标卡尺的固定刻度读数为1.3cm,游标尺上第7个刻度游标读数为0.1*7mm=0.7mm=0.07cm,所以最终读数为:1.3cm+0.07cm=1.37cm;故答案为:深度,0.9,1.37.

井索雯3717高中物理,,关于游标卡尺,,图中俩游标卡尺,同样都是游标尺的10个刻度对应主尺九个,为啥精度不一样 -
狄凤帜18456311339 ______ 同样都是游标尺的10个刻度对应主尺九个,这是错误的, 而是:一个是10个刻度对应主尺九个,另一个是20个刻度对应主尺十九个,所以精度不一样.
